Halloween hijinks ensue when the monsters bring out their trampoline!

A rollicking rhyming text that features the monsters we all know and love as they carry out their favorite Halloween routine--jumping on their trampoline!

In the process, Vampire loses a fang while eating a tangerine and Werewolf howls at the moon while playing the tambourine. But the fun continues as they bounce high over pumpkin patches, haunted houses, and trick-or-treaters dressed nice and mean.

About the Author
Scott Rothman is a writer of kid's books, theater, screenplays, and humor pieces. Scott's debut picture book, Attack of the Underwear Dragon, and its sequel, Return of the Underwear Dragon were both national indie bestsellers. His other books include Warm and Fuzzy, Kittybunkport, Blue Bison Needs a Haircut, and Parfait, Not Parfait. Scott lives in Connecticut (of all places), where he recently bought a trampoline that he will put together sometime in the next ten to fifty years. He wishes all his readers the happiest of Halloweens.

Rob Justus is an award-winning author, illustrator, and graphic novelist. His graphic novel series, Death & Sparkles won a Manitoba Young Readers' Choice Award in 2023. In 2022, Rob was selected as the illustrator for the prestigious TD Summer Reading Club in Canada. Prior to all this, Rob spent nearly a decade as a market researcher writing very bland reports. Taking a chance on himself, Rob decided to return to his childhood passion of drawing and storytelling and hasn't looked back. Rob has wiritten and illustrated five picture books and two graphic novels. When Rob isn't telling people he draws awesome things for a living, he is wrangling his two young boys in Ottawa, Canada.
